随着数字化转型的深入,企业对数据的依赖程度不断提高。多模态大数据平台作为一种新兴的技术架构,能够整合和处理多种类型的数据(如文本、图像、音频、视频等),为企业提供更全面的洞察和决策支持。本文将深入探讨多模态大数据平台的技术架构、实现方法以及其在实际应用中的价值。
一、什么是多模态大数据平台?
多模态大数据平台是一种能够同时处理和分析多种数据类型的综合性平台。与传统的单一数据类型处理平台(如仅处理结构化数据的数据库)不同,多模态大数据平台能够整合文本、图像、音频、视频、传感器数据等多种数据形式,并通过先进的技术手段实现数据的融合、分析和可视化。
1.1 多模态数据的特点
- 多样性:支持多种数据格式,包括结构化数据(如表格数据)、半结构化数据(如JSON、XML)和非结构化数据(如文本、图像、视频)。
- 复杂性:不同数据类型之间的关联性和交互性较强,需要复杂的处理和分析技术。
- 实时性:部分场景(如实时监控、物联网)要求平台能够快速处理和反馈数据。
1.2 多模态大数据平台的核心价值
- 提升决策效率:通过整合多源数据,提供更全面的分析结果,帮助企业做出更明智的决策。
- 增强用户体验:通过多维度的数据展示,为企业用户提供更直观、更丰富的信息呈现方式。
- 支持新兴应用:如数字孪生、智能推荐、实时监控等领域,多模态数据处理能力是其成功的关键。
二、多模态大数据平台的技术架构
多模态大数据平台的技术架构通常包括以下几个关键组成部分:
2.1 数据采集层
- 功能:负责从多种数据源(如数据库、文件系统、物联网设备、社交媒体等)采集数据。
- 技术:支持多种数据格式和协议,如HTTP、FTP、MQTT等。
- 挑战:需要处理数据的异构性和实时性问题。
2.2 数据存储层
- 功能:对采集到的多模态数据进行存储和管理。
- 技术:采用分布式存储系统(如Hadoop、HBase、Elasticsearch)和对象存储(如AWS S3、阿里云OSS)。
- 特点:支持大规模数据存储和高效的查询性能。
2.3 数据处理层
- 功能:对存储的数据进行清洗、转换和预处理。
- 技术:使用分布式计算框架(如Spark、Flink)和流处理技术(如Kafka、Storm)。
- 挑战:需要处理数据的多样性和复杂性,确保处理效率和准确性。
2.4 数据融合层
- 功能:将不同数据源和数据类型的数据进行关联和融合。
- 技术:基于知识图谱、自然语言处理(NLP)和机器学习(ML)等技术,实现数据的语义理解和关联。
- 价值:通过数据融合,提供更全面的洞察。
2.5 数据建模与分析层
- 功能:对融合后的数据进行建模和分析,提取有价值的信息。
- 技术:使用机器学习、深度学习(如CNN、RNN)、统计分析等技术。
- 应用场景:如预测分析、分类、聚类等。
2.6 数据可视化层
- 功能:将分析结果以直观的方式呈现给用户。
- 技术:使用可视化工具(如Tableau、Power BI、D3.js)和实时可视化技术。
- 特点:支持多维度、多模态的数据展示,如图表、地图、3D模型等。
2.7 数据安全与治理层
- 功能:确保数据的安全性、隐私性和合规性。
- 技术:采用数据加密、访问控制、数据脱敏等技术。
- 挑战:随着数据量的增加,数据治理的难度也在增加。
2.8 平台扩展性
- 功能:支持平台的横向扩展和纵向扩展,以应对数据量和用户需求的增长。
- 技术:采用微服务架构、容器化(如Docker)、 orchestration(如Kubernetes)等技术。
三、多模态大数据平台的实现方法
3.1 需求分析
在构建多模态大数据平台之前,需要进行充分的需求分析,明确平台的目标用户、功能需求、性能需求以及安全性需求。
3.2 技术选型
根据需求选择合适的技术栈:
- 数据采集:根据数据源的类型选择合适的采集工具(如Flume、Logstash)。
- 数据存储:根据数据量和查询需求选择合适的存储系统(如Hadoop、Elasticsearch)。
- 数据处理:选择分布式计算框架(如Spark、Flink)。
- 数据融合:选择知识图谱构建工具(如Neo4j)和NLP工具(如spaCy、HanLP)。
- 数据建模与分析:选择机器学习框架(如TensorFlow、PyTorch)。
- 数据可视化:选择可视化工具(如Tableau、D3.js)。
3.3 模块开发
根据技术架构设计,逐步开发各个模块:
- 数据采集模块:实现数据的采集和初步处理。
- 数据存储模块:实现数据的存储和管理。
- 数据处理模块:实现数据的清洗、转换和预处理。
- 数据融合模块:实现多模态数据的关联和融合。
- 数据建模与分析模块:实现数据的建模和分析。
- 数据可视化模块:实现分析结果的可视化展示。
3.4 测试与优化
在开发过程中,需要进行单元测试、集成测试和性能测试,确保平台的稳定性和高效性。
3.5 部署与维护
将平台部署到生产环境,并进行日常的维护和优化,确保平台的正常运行。
四、多模态大数据平台的应用场景
4.1 智能制造
- 应用:通过整合生产设备的数据、生产流程数据、传感器数据等,实现生产过程的智能化监控和优化。
- 价值:提高生产效率、降低生产成本、提升产品质量。
4.2 智慧城市
- 应用:通过整合交通数据、环境数据、人口数据等,实现城市运行的智能化管理。
- 价值:优化城市资源配置、提升城市管理水平、改善市民生活质量。
4.3 医疗健康
- 应用:通过整合患者的电子健康记录、医学影像、基因数据等,实现精准医疗和个性化治疗。
- 价值:提高医疗诊断的准确性和效率,改善患者的治疗效果。
4.4 金融风控
- 应用:通过整合客户的交易数据、信用数据、社交媒体数据等,实现金融风险的智能化评估和预警。
- 价值:降低金融风险、提升金融服务的智能化水平。
五、多模态大数据平台的挑战与解决方案
5.1 数据异构性
- 挑战:不同数据源和数据类型的数据格式和结构差异较大,难以统一处理。
- 解决方案:采用数据标准化、数据转换和数据映射等技术,实现数据的统一管理和处理。
5.2 数据计算复杂性
- 挑战:多模态数据的处理和分析需要复杂的计算和算法支持。
- 解决方案:采用分布式计算框架和高性能计算技术,提升数据处理和分析的效率。
5.3 数据隐私与安全
- 挑战:多模态数据的整合和共享可能带来数据隐私和安全问题。
- 解决方案:采用数据加密、访问控制、数据脱敏等技术,确保数据的安全性和隐私性。
5.4 平台扩展性
- 挑战:随着数据量和用户需求的增加,平台需要具备良好的扩展性。
- 解决方案:采用微服务架构、容器化和 orchestration 等技术,实现平台的横向和纵向扩展。
六、多模态大数据平台的未来发展趋势
6.1 AI驱动的数据处理
- 趋势:随着人工智能技术的不断发展,多模态大数据平台将更加智能化,能够自动处理和分析数据。
- 价值:提升数据处理的效率和准确性,降低人工干预成本。
6.2 边缘计算
- 趋势:多模态大数据平台将与边缘计算技术结合,实现数据的实时处理和分析。
- 价值:降低数据传输和存储的成本,提升数据处理的实时性和响应速度。
6.3 增强的可视化技术
- 趋势:多模态大数据平台将采用更先进的可视化技术,如虚拟现实(VR)、增强现实(AR)等,提供更沉浸式的数据展示体验。
- 价值:提升用户体验,增强数据的直观性和可理解性。
6.4 数据隐私与合规性
- 趋势:随着数据隐私法规的不断完善,多模态大数据平台将更加注重数据隐私和合规性。
- 价值:确保数据的安全性和合规性,提升用户对平台的信任度。
6.5 平台生态化
- 趋势:多模态大数据平台将向生态化方向发展,吸引更多的开发者和合作伙伴加入。
- 价值:丰富平台的功能和应用,提升平台的竞争力和影响力。
七、结语
多模态大数据平台作为一种新兴的技术架构,正在为企业数字化转型提供强有力的支持。通过整合和处理多种类型的数据,多模态大数据平台能够为企业提供更全面的洞察和决策支持。然而,构建和运维多模态大数据平台也面临诸多挑战,需要企业在技术选型、数据安全、平台扩展性等方面进行深入思考和规划。
如果您对多模态大数据平台感兴趣,或者希望了解更多信息,可以申请试用相关平台,体验其强大的功能和价值。申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。